  37. I’m a skeptic, too. I do believe this can work for other people, people selling higher price products, but not for people selling lower price products. By low price, I mean $2.99 or $3.99. Has anyone ever used your course to successfully sell products (in my case novels and novellas in ebook form) at these prices?

    • One of my most successful clients has launched many times at the $10 price point.

      The real question is what else could possibly work for you at that low a price point? Clearly, the people having real success in your market are building a tribe of followers (ie, an email list) and then they’re marketing to those people. And the most effective way to sell to that type of a list is with a sequence… which is just another word for a launch.
